  10. It has a SP component and Uru live, presumably the MMO component. I picked it up yesterday but so far other than nice environments everything seems... dead. I've not explored every corner but so far no journals to add intrigue or sightings of other inhabatents ala riven or exile in the SP component. Beyond the brief hologram at the start telling you to find du'ni and look for the pieces of tapestry in each age, there doesn't seem to be much info about du'ni scattered through the ruins. Overall first impression: Graphics 9/10 (a glitch every now and again) Gameplay 7/10 (lack of life in SP, odd controls.)
